From: A putative N-BAR-domain protein is crucially required for the development of hyphae tip appressorium-like structure and its plant infection in Magnaporthe oryzae

Fig. 6

MoBar-A essentially promotes the formation of appressorium-like structures in Magnaporthe oryzae. a Development of appressorium-like structures by the ΔMobar-A, ΔMobar-B, ΔMobar-A/ΔMobar-B, and the wild-type strains inoculated on artificial appressorium-inducing hydrophobic cover-slides and barley leaves. scale bar, 10 μm. b Column digram showing the number of appressorium-like structures produced by the individual strains inoculated on barley leaves. The error bars represent standard errors from at least three independent replicates (**, P < 0.01 by t-test). c The expression level of genes associated with the formation of appressorium-like structures in the ΔMobar-A, ΔMobar-B and ΔMobar-A/ΔMobar-B strains compared with that in the wild-type strain. The qPCR results were generated from three independent biological replications with three technical replicates. The error bars represent mean ± SD
